Marvel Studios’ Black Panther: Wakanda Forever – Check Out Official Trailer

Marvel Entertainment revealed the official trailer for Black Panther: Wakanda Forever, coming to theaters on November 11.

“Show them who we are.”

Black Panther: Wakanda Forever is the 30th film in the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) and also a direct sequel to Black Panther (2018). The development of the sequel was confirmed in mid-2019, with the original plans featuring the return of Chadwick Boseman in the role of King T’Challa, the Black Panther. Tragically, the actor died from colon cancer.

Marvel chose not to recast T’Challa and pressed on with Wakanda Forever. The film is directed by Ryan Coogler and stars many familiar faces: Letitia Wright (Shuri), Lupita Nyong’o (Nakia), Danai Gurira (Okoye), Winston Duke (M’Baku), Martin Freeman (Everett Ross), and Angela Bassett (Ramonda, the Queen Mother of Wakanda).

In Black Panther: Wakanda Forever, the beloved characters fight to protect their nation from intervening world powers in the wake of King T’Challa’s death. As the Wakandans strive to embrace their next chapter, the heroes must band together with the help of War Dog Nakia and Everett Ross and forge a new path for the kingdom of Wakanda.
